One False Move - Harlequin

Buy at Amazon



Track List:

1. I Did It For Love
2. Hard Road
3. Shame If You Leave Me
4. Say Goodnight
5. Ready To Love Again
6. Fine Line
7. Heart Gone Cold
8. Heavy Talk
9. Superstitious Feeling
10. It's A Woman You Need


AOR / Pop
1982
Canada

Harlequin is another AOR act, this time from Canada. They didn't really make it too big in the 80's, but did have some good music nonetheless.
